The Mascenic Regional Vikings are taking a road trip to take on the Mount Royal Academy Knights at 6:30 p.m. on Friday.
Last Monday, Mascenic Regional ended up a good deal behind Epping and lost 55-41.
Meanwhile, win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Mount Royal Academy). They enjoyed a cozy 62-43 win over Pittsfield on Wednesday.
Mascenic Regional's loss dropped their record down to 7-9. As for Mount Royal Academy, their victory (their first of the season) made their record 1-15.
Everything went Mascenic Regional's way against Mount Royal Academy in their previous matchup back in January, as Mascenic Regional made off with a 65-41 win. The rematch might be a little tougher for Mascenic Regional since the team won't have the home-court adv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
